Flesh Pale to pinkish-buff, fragile to firm, produing a white milk on cutting which turns yellow after a minute or two Smell Slight, like Lactarius quietus Taste Acrid and bitter Season Autumn Distribution Frequent Habitat With conifers, especially pines Spore Print Cream-yellow Edibility Not edible |
